  1. Well lets go over it... The Millennium or the 1000 year reign of Christ with His saints comes about, but the Bible says it is in heaven, not on earth. The millennium is the thousand-year reign of Christ with His saints in heaven between the first and second resurrections. During this time the wicked dead will be judged and the earth will be utterly desolate, without any living human inhabitants, but occupied by Satan and his evil angels. At the close of the Millennium or the 1000 years in heaven, Christ with His saints and the Holy City will descend from heaven to earth. The wicked dead will then be resurrected and face the final judgement, along with Satan and his angels at the Lake of Fire which will consume them and cleanse the earth of sin forever. Now Revelation 19 and 20 belong together; there is no break between these chapters. They describe Christ's coming (Rev. 19:11-21) and immediately continue with the millennium, their sequence indicating that the millennium or 1000 years begins when Christ returns. It is only the devil and all the evil angels who will inhabit Earth during the 1,000 years. The events of these 1,000 years were foreshadowed in the scapegoat ritual of the Day of Atonement in Israel's sanctuary service. On the Day of Atonement the high priest cleansed the sanctuary with the atoning blood of the Lord's goat. Only after this atonement was fully completed did the ritual involving Azazel, the goat that symbolized Satan, begin. Laying his hands on its head, the high priest confessed "'all the iniquities of the children of Israel, and all their transgressions, concerning all their sins, putting them on the head of the goat'" (Lev. 16:21). And the scapegoat was sent into the wilderness, "'an uninhabited land'" (Lev. 16:22). There is no one for Satan to deceive for 1000 years. The expression, "bottomless pit," as is evident from other scriptures, is used to represent the earth in a state of confusion and darkness. Concerning the condition of the earth "in the beginning," the Bible record says that it " was without form, and void; and darkness was upon the face of the deep." (Gen. 1:2) The word translated here "DEEP" is the same in that REV. 20:1-3 is rendered "BOTTOMLESS PIT " Satan is actually on the earth for the 1000 years with the desolation left behind as no one is alive as the wicked are left dead after the Second Coming and described in Jeremiah. Jeremiah 4 23 I beheld the earth, and, lo, it was without form, and void; and the heavens, and they had no light. 24 I beheld the mountains, and, lo, they trembled, and all the hills moved lightly. 25 I beheld, and, lo, there was no man, and all the birds of the heavens were fled. 26 I beheld, and, lo, the fruitful place was a wilderness, and all the cities thereof were broken down at the presence of the Lord, and by his fierce anger. 27 For thus hath the Lord said, The whole land shall be desolate; yet will I not make a full end. The earth is left desolate. There is no man nor bird, the earth and its cities are broken down. But God does not make a full end. This has yet to be fulfilled and will happen after the 1000 years.
